Just been looking at the Sweden #s compared to their neighbors Norway and Finland who are both on lockdown. Sweden has a population of about 10million, the other two about 5m each,

Cases 4947 Deaths 239

Norway https://www.worldometers.info/coronavirus/country/norway/
Cases 4828 Deaths 43

Finland
Cases 1446 Deaths 17

Norway has a high case number but low % of deaths, seems like they have been doing a lot of testing along with their lockdown

Finland and Sweden had their first case around the end of Jan, Norway Feb 25th which could account for their low fatality rate to date but not the difference between Finland and Sweden
Sweden New Cases +621 Total Cases 5568 New deaths +69 Total Deaths 308
Norway New cases +265 Total Cases 5142 New deaths +6 Total Deaths 50
Finland New Cases +72 Total Cases 1518 New deaths +2 Total Deaths 19
